Transaction 7c6084ae0563aca0c12cbab117a670df51efaa116c1f522a48d86a0b27751106
1 Input
1 Output
-
7c6084ae0563aca0c12cbab117a670df51efaa116c1f522a48d86a0b27751106:0
- value
- 75250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5b720e0ab3b95fdb3f0aa94d1b5720828027e4b OP_EQUAL
- address
- 3MB3EPZqjHuNMakEmxAiys2L8rSad5DmR6